Sterile Disposable Adhesive Plaster Sourcing Guide

The market for sterile disposable adhesive plasters presents a diverse range of options tailored for hospital, personal protection, and family applications. Buyers observe products categorized as passive dressings or wound dressings, often featuring ventilation and anti-allergy properties to ensure patient comfort. These items are typically designed for single-use scenarios in clinics and sports support settings, with materials ranging from non-woven fibers to cotton, PVC, PE, and PU blends.

Procurement decisions must account for the variability in product shapes and sizes, which include round, square, rectangle, and butterfly configurations. Specific dimensions observed in listings range from small 22mm units to larger 10cm by 4m rolls, allowing for customization based on wound type. Sourcing strategies should prioritize suppliers who offer free samples to validate the physical attributes of the adhesive and the breathability of the non-woven fiber before committing to bulk orders.

Technical Specifications to Verify

Technical due diligence requires a precise match between the product model and the required wound dimensions, as specifications vary from 22mm to 72mm widths. Buyers must confirm the material composition, ensuring the blend of cotton, elastic, or synthetic polymers meets the specific needs of the patient group, whether adult or general use. The shape of the plaster, whether round, square, or butterfly, must be validated against the anatomical site of application to ensure optimal coverage and flexibility.

Sterilization status is a critical technical parameter that dictates the safety profile of the final product. While some listings explicitly state Ethylene Oxide Sterilization, others indicate the absence of this process, which necessitates a clear understanding of the intended use environment. Procurement teams should verify the weight of the adhesive and the specific standard, such as nonwoven fiber or specific metric dimensions, to ensure the product performs reliably under clinical conditions without causing allergic reactions.

Compliance and Safety Documentation

Regulatory compliance is paramount, with many suppliers listing CE, ISO, and FDA certifications as standard requirements for international trade. Buyers must distinguish between general certifications and specific medical device standards like ISO13485, which are often cited in the product attributes for wound dressings. The presence of these certificates suggests adherence to quality management systems, but verification of the specific certificate number and validity is essential before finalizing any purchase agreement.

Safety documentation must also address the instrument classification, which is typically listed as Class I for these types of dressings. This classification implies a lower risk profile but still requires rigorous adherence to safety standards regarding biocompatibility and sterility. Procurement teams should request proof of the "Quality Guarantee Period," which is observed as two years in some listings, to ensure long-term reliability and to understand the shelf-life constraints associated with the disinfection and sterilization methods used.

Cost Drivers and Commercial Terms

Pricing in this sector is highly variable, with observed ranges spanning from $0.01 to $3 per unit depending on material complexity and order volume. The Minimum Order Quantity (MOQ) is a significant cost driver, ranging from single units for sampling to one million units for large-scale industrial distribution. Buyers must calculate the total landed cost by factoring in the packaging type, such as export cartons or metal packing, which can add substantial weight and volume to the shipment.

Commercial terms often include options for logo printing and customized packaging, which can increase the unit price but add value for brand-specific distribution. The availability of free samples is a common market signal that allows buyers to test the product without immediate financial commitment. However, procurement teams should be aware that customization requests may trigger higher MOQs or longer lead times, requiring careful negotiation to balance cost efficiency with specific branding or sizing requirements.
